Visit Charming Towns and Villages

If you are looking for a relaxing and charming way to spend your Sunday in the South Shore, why not visit one of the many picturesque towns and villages in the region? These quaint destinations offer a variety of activities and attractions to explore, making them perfect for a day trip.

One of the must-visit destinations in the South Shore is the town of Plymouth, known for its rich history and charming waterfront. Take a leisurely stroll along the Plymouth Harbor and enjoy the breathtaking views of the boats and the iconic Plymouth Rock. Explore the historical sites such as Mayflower II, a replica of the ship that brought the Pilgrims to America, and the Plimoth Plantation, where you can step back in time and experience life in the 17th century.

If you are a fan of art and culture, make sure to visit the town of Duxbury. This idyllic village is home to several art galleries and studios showcasing the works of local artists. Take a walk around the charming streets and admire the historic architecture, or visit the Duxbury Art Complex Museum, which houses an impressive collection of American art.

For nature enthusiasts, the town of Hingham is a paradise. Explore the picturesque Hingham Harbor and take a scenic hike along the Weir River Estuary Trail. If you are looking for a more active adventure, you can rent a kayak or paddleboard and explore the beautiful coastline.
